2. Creating a New Workflow in Pabbly Connect
To create a new workflow, click on the Create Workflow button. Name your workflow according to its purpose, such as ‘Sync Slack Status With Calendly.’ Choose a folder to save your workflow in and click on Create.
- Select the trigger application as Calendly.
- Choose the event trigger as Invite Created by User.
- Connect your Calendly account to Pabbly Connect.
After setting the trigger, click on Save and Test to ensure that the connection is successful. This will allow Pabbly Connect to receive data whenever a new invite is created in Calendly.
3. Setting Up Slack Integration Through Pabbly Connect
Next, you need to set up the action application, which is Slack. In the action step, select Slack and choose the action event as Set Status. This will allow you to update your Slack status based on the invite details from Calendly.
Click on Connect to link your Slack account with Pabbly Connect. You will need to select the token type as User and allow access to your Slack account. After a successful connection, you can set the status text, emoji, and expiration time.
- Use the description from the Calendly invite as your status text.
- Choose an emoji for your status, ensuring it is formatted correctly.
- Set the expiration time to match the end time of the event in Unix timestamp format.
After filling in all the necessary details, click on Save and Test to finalize the Slack integration.
4. Finalizing the Integration Process in Pabbly Connect
After setting up both the trigger and action applications, you need to add a delay to ensure the Slack status updates only when the event starts. In the action tab, select Delay by Pabbly and choose Add Time Delay as the action event.
Map the start date and time from the Calendly invite response to the delay action. This ensures that the workflow is delayed until the event actually starts. Once you have set the delay, click on Save and Test to confirm the settings.
Now, your workflow is ready. Whenever a new invite is created in Calendly, your Slack status will automatically update based on the invite details. This integration ensures your team is always informed of your availability.
